This charming and whimsical 3-season cottage offers a perfect escape from the hustle and bustle of everyday life. Nestled on a lovely 0.39-acre lot with 70 feet of riverfront, the property provides a serene environment with excellent fishing and boating opportunities. The cottage itself boasts a cozy interior with custom hardwood floors, shiplap walls, and wood ceilings that enhance its rustic charm. The updated kitchen adds modern convenience to this delightful retreat. The property includes a bunkie, adding extra space for guests or storage. The waterfront features a shallow entry that deepens off the dock, complete with a marine rail, making it ideal for various water activities. The south-facing lot ensures plenty of sunlight, and the year-round private road access makes it a convenient getaway. Located between Torrance and Gravenhurst, the cottage is easily accessible from the GTA, making it an ideal spot for weekend retreats or longer vacations. The tranquil setting on the Trent Severn Waterway embodies the essence of seclusion, peace, and tranquility, making this cottage a truly special place to unwind and enjoy nature. (67681805)
